I like the multi-family market a lot better down here in Tucson than I do up in the Phoenix area. Normal biases in my familiarity with the market, but I've personally been reasonably successful getting buyers under contract down here... particularly over the last few months.

I'm seeing $90-120/door for C class areas and $130-150/door for A class, so right in line with what you were hoping to spend. As Tucson's rental rates were pretty flat for a long time (up until maybe 5-7 years ago) there is a lot of product with deferred maintenance and crazy low rents, which I think lends itself well to house hacking. For sure it's competitive but still better numbers than I'm seeing hit the ARMLS up the 10.
